Nortech Systems Incorporated (NSYS) recently released its the previous quarter earnings results, reporting an earnings per share (EPS) of -0.05 and total quarterly revenue of $118,365,000. These figures represent the latest available official financial data for the firm as of the current reporting date, covering all operational activity for the the previous quarter period. Management Commentary

During the official the previous quarter earnings call, Nortech Systems Incorporated leadership discussed the core drivers of the quarter’s financial results. Management noted that persistent supply chain frictions in select industrial end markets, paired with temporary labor cost pressures in core manufacturing facilities, contributed to the negative EPS print for the period. Leadership also highlighted that softening short-term order volumes from clients in the industrial automation segment weighed on top line performance during the previous quarter. On a more positive note, management pointed to strong performance in the company’s medical device manufacturing segment, which exceeded internal operational targets for the quarter, offsetting a portion of the weakness in other verticals. Leadership also confirmed that the company rolled out a series of cost optimization initiatives during the previous quarter, including targeted operational streamlining and redundant role reductions, that are designed to improve margin performance over time. Forward Guidance

NSYS provided cautious, non-specific forward commentary during the the previous quarter earnings call, avoiding concrete numerical projections due to ongoing macroeconomic uncertainty. Management noted that prevailing volatility in global manufacturing supply chains and fluctuating customer demand across some of its core end markets could continue to put pressure on financial performance in the near term. Leadership also stated that its ongoing cost optimization efforts would likely deliver measurable operational efficiency gains if executed as planned, which may support margin improvements moving forward. The company also highlighted that its ongoing investments in new production capacity for aerospace and defense client contracts could unlock incremental revenue streams in the medium term, though these opportunities are subject to standard regulatory approval and client onboarding timelines. Market Reaction

Following the public release of the previous quarter earnings results, NSYS shares traded with above-average volume in subsequent trading sessions, with price action reflecting mixed investor sentiment. Analysts covering the firm noted that the reported revenue figure was roughly aligned with broad pre-release market expectations, while the negative EPS print was slightly softer than the consensus analyst estimate published ahead of the release. Some equity research analysts have highlighted the company’s exposure to high-growth end markets including medical devices and aerospace as potential long-term value drivers, while flagging ongoing demand weakness in industrial segments as a possible downside risk. Market participants are expected to monitor the company’s execution of its announced cost optimization plans, as well as order flow trends across its core segments, in upcoming trading periods to assess future performance trajectories.
